Floor joint construction device, system and method
The invention belongs to the technical field of building construction, particularly relates to a floor joint construction device, system and method, and aims to solve the problems of high template support consumption, labor and time waste and poor pouring strength of a floor post-pouring slab joint. The device comprises a bottom bearing component, a bottom fixing component, N height adjusting components and N opposite-pulling components. The bottom bearing component is arranged at the bottom of the floor joint to seal the bottom of the floor joint; the bottom fixing component is arranged at the bottom of the bottom bearing component and used for abutting the bottom bearing component against the bottom of the floor joint. The N height adjusting components are arranged at the upper part of the floor joint; the N height adjusting components are used for adjusting the heights of the N opposite-pulling components; the structure is simple, integral pouring of the same floor joint can be carried out, the pouring strength is greatly improved, the construction period is shortened, potential safety hazards are reduced, and meanwhile damage to an original structure is avoided.
